Detox and rehabilitation are not the same thing
Detox is the clinically managed procedure of getting rid of alcohol from your system while managing withdrawal signs and symptoms. It is short, generally 3 to 7 days. The primary objective is safety and security. The additional objective is comfort.
Rehab is what comes next. It consists of therapy, education and learning, medication for relapse avoidance, household work, and technique living without alcohol. Rehabilitation can be domestic, partial a hospital stay, or outpatient. It usually recently to months. Think of detox as a runway and rehabilitation as the trip. You need both to get to a destination.

Day one and the initial 72 hours
The consumption registered nurse will certainly check important indicators, blood alcohol web content if relevant, and location you on a standardized evaluation like CIWA‑Ar, a confirmed tool that ratings withdrawal symptoms. You will generally get thiamine, folate, and a multivitamin very early to safeguard the mind and protect against Wernicke's encephalopathy, which is unusual however significant. If you are already shaky, sweaty, nervous, or nauseated, the medical professional or registered nurse specialist starts symptom‑driven medication promptly.
Here is how the initial stretch commonly unfolds.
- Hour 0 to 12: Consumption, labs, hydration, vitamins, and a very first dose of medication if shown. You might really feel groggy or agitated. Staff look at you often.
- Hour 12 to 24: Signs and symptoms can increase. Trembling, anxiety, bad rest, and blood pressure spikes prevail. Medicine doses are adapted to your rating and vitals. Straightforward food, fluids, and brief walks help.
- Day 2: If withdrawal risks are higher, this is a critical day. Seizure threat is greater in the first 48 hours. The group watches very closely. Lots of individuals start to stabilize, with less trembling and much better sleep.
- Day 3: Signs usually relieve. The team shifts toward preparation. You meet a counselor, go over triggers, and map the following degree of treatment. If readily available, you may participate in a brief team or a one‑on‑one session.
- Day 4 to 7: Size relies on intensity, co‑occurring conditions, and response to medicines. Some discharge on day 3, others need a few even more days to land gently.
Families in some cases fear that medications merely replace one substance with another. Done appropriately, detoxification depends on brief training courses of medications that taper off as signs settle. The plan is customized and time‑limited.
Medications made use of in alcohol detox
Most systems utilize symptom‑triggered benzodiazepines, since this course lowers the threat of seizures and ecstasy tremens when alcohol quits. Usual options consist of diazepam and lorazepam. Dosages are not one size fits all. Older adults, individuals with liver disease, or those with serious rest apnea require mindful adjustments.
Adjuncts ease specific symptoms. Gabapentin can decrease anxiousness and insomnia. Clonidine or propranolol assists with free signs like quick heart price and trembling. Hydroxyzine or trazodone supports rest. Antipsychotics such as haloperidol may be utilized briefly for extreme agitation or hallucinations, yet not as a standalone for seizure avoidance. Thiamine is non‑negotiable, offered prior to sugar when possible. Much more severe or complex situations occasionally require inpatient healthcare facility monitoring with IV fluids, electrolyte correction, and continuous monitoring.
A great detoxification program aims for the most affordable efficient drug dosage and quits it as soon as it is secure. The goal is not a chemical padding for weeks. It is risk-free passage.
Understanding threat: who requires inpatient detox
Not everyone requires inpatient detoxification. Light to moderate withdrawal can be managed at home with daily center check‑ins and prescriptions, especially when there is strong social assistance and no major health conditions. That stated, specific variables push the scale towards overseen treatment:
- History of withdrawal seizures or delirium tremens, even once.
- Heavy or long period of time of drinking, for instance a pint or even more of liquor daily for months.
- Significant medical issues such as heart problem, unrestrained diabetic issues, or liver failure.
- Pregnant individuals, who require worked with obstetric and dependency care.
- Lack of a trusted sober caretaker at home.

What rehabilitation appears like after detox
The handoff from detoxification to rehab shapes the following six months. Strong programs develop that bridge early. You will likely meet an instance supervisor or counselor by day 2 that routines the very first consultations, prepares transportation when required, and checks insurance policy coverage. Options include:
- Residential rehab, generally 2 to 4 weeks, for those who need a structured setting without very easy access to alcohol.
- Partial a hospital stay, 5 days per week for a number of hours each day, with nights at home.
- Intensive outpatient, 3 to 4 days each week, typically in the evenings to stabilize job or family.
- Standard outpatient treatment, one or two times weekly, frequently combined with peer support.
Therapies differ, but cognitive behavior modification and inspirational speaking with are mainstays. Numerous programs in this area add trauma‑informed care, family sessions, and skills training for sleep, tension, and communication. An effective alcohol rehab Tinton Falls strategy looks mundane theoretically yet requiring in life: constant therapy, peer connection, medicine when ideal, and day‑to‑day problem fixing in the house and work.
Medication for relapse prevention
Detox addresses withdrawal, not desire or regression danger. Recurring alcohol addiction treatment frequently consists of medicine:
- Naltrexone reduces benefit from drinking and can decrease hefty alcohol consumption days. It comes as a day-to-day pill or a regular monthly shot. It is a good suitable for several, unless there is intense liver disease or opioid use.
- Acamprosate supports abstaining by alleviating post‑acute signs and symptoms like internal restlessness. It is dosed three times day-to-day and works best when you are alcohol‑free.
- Disulfiram produces an aversive reaction if you drink on it. It benefits people who desire a solid outside brake and have trustworthy supervision.
- Off label medicines such as topiramate or gabapentin can assist some people that do not endure first‑line options.
The choice depends on goals. Someone going for complete abstaining may select acamprosate or naltrexone. Someone trying to minimize heavy drinking days, en course to abstinence, may start with naltrexone. An individual with extreme liver illness calls for added caution and frequently favors acamprosate.

Special populaces and medical judgment
One size never ever fits all. Right here are scenarios where strategies usually change:
- Older grownups metabolize medicines in a different way, and drop threat is genuine. Reduced benzodiazepine dosages, slower tapers, and additional focus to hydration and electrolytes stop complications.
- People with liver illness call for mindful medicine option. Lorazepam is often favored in severe liver disability since it avoids active metabolites. Naltrexone might be postponed up until liver feature improves.
- Pregnant clients need collaborated treatment. The concern is maternal stablizing, fetal surveillance when indicated, and mindful medicine options. Early prenatal control makes a difference.
- Those with co‑occurring psychological health conditions benefit from incorporated treatment. Treat without treatment depression, PTSD, or ADHD together with alcohol usage condition. Stay clear of chasing after one problem at a time.
- People with chronic discomfort demand realistic strategies. An excellent program brings pain monitoring into the conversation early, with non‑opioid strategies, physical treatment recommendations, and coordinated prescribing.
The common thread is customization. The ideal plan is the one you can adhere to safely, not the one that looks suitable on paper.

Therapy that sticks after detox
People do not relapse for absence of info. They regression when stress and anxiety spikes, sleep collapses, or they encounter an old pattern without a strategy. Effective treatment targets those actual moments. If alcohol rehab consists of only lectures, you will certainly find out intriguing facts and little else. Programs that mix private treatment, skills practice, and peer discussion educate you to take care of the edge cases: the coworker that pressures you repetitively, the wedding anniversary of a loss, the evening you do not drop off to sleep up until 3 a.m.
Look for a plan that rehearses reactions. Method stating no with a full sentence. Technique leaving a celebration in the first 15 minutes without explanation. Method ordering soda water with lime without a lengthy tale. It feels unpleasant initially. It obtains easier quickly.
Medication plus treatment is not a crutch. It is a clever pairing. People that make use of both have a tendency to remain involved longer.

What progression really looks like
New clients sometimes anticipate a rise of power once the alcohol leaves. What they really feel is much more subtle. The very first genuine win is generally a stable hand. After that a complete night of sleep turns up, often between days 3 and 7. Morning nausea discolors. Blood pressure normalizes. The mind clears sufficient to find patterns.
Cravings can be found in waves. The first clean peaceful Saturday can feel vacant and risky. A great strategy fills it with straightforward framework: a conference, a walk, food preparation something you actually wish to consume, a phone call with a person secure. Over weeks, power returns. Over months, self-confidence expands. The brain's reward system, down‑regulated by years of alcohol, alters. It does not break back in a week. It alters with repetition.
Common misconceptions that get in the way
Two concepts create a great deal of harm. The very first is waiting for ideal readiness. Readiness is not a door that opens totally. It is a window that splits. If the home window is open today, relocation. Programs in Tinton Falls can typically start the procedure rapidly as soon as you call.
The secondly is the misconception that one slip removes progress. A slip is data. It tells you where the strategy was thin. Use it to strengthen the strategy, not to validate a story that you can not change. People who mount slides as details come back on track faster.

How long does it take to fully cleanse your body of alcohol in Tinton Falls?
Alcohol is generally eliminated from the body within about 24 hours after the last drink, although this varies by the amount consumed and individual metabolism. Recovery from the physical effects of heavy alcohol use may take much longer. Withdrawal symptoms can last several days. Long-term healing depends on overall health and continued recovery.
What do 7 days of no alcohol do in Tinton Falls?
After seven days without alcohol, many people notice improved sleep, hydration, and mental clarity. Blood alcohol is fully eliminated well before this point, and early withdrawal symptoms often begin to improve. Energy levels and concentration may also increase. Individual experiences vary depending on previous drinking patterns and overall health.
How long until alcohol is 100% out of your system in Tinton Falls?
For most people, alcohol is completely eliminated from the bloodstream within approximately 24 hours after the last drink. The exact timing depends on body size, liver function, and the amount of alcohol consumed. Standard alcohol tests may detect alcohol for different lengths of time depending on the testing method. Recovery from alcohol use extends beyond the time alcohol remains in the body.
What are the stages of alcohol detox in Tinton Falls?
Alcohol detox typically begins with mild symptoms such as anxiety, sweating, nausea, and tremors within the first day. Moderate symptoms may develop over the next one to three days, and severe cases can involve seizures or delirium tremens. Symptoms usually begin to improve after several days with appropriate medical care. The severity varies depending on the individual's history of alcohol use.
